<?php $status = 'NO'; $resultados = null; try { include_once '../../../config.php'; if (isset($_SESSION['idPessoaProprietario'])) { $obj = new ContaReceber(Conf::pegCnxPadrao()); $obj->setIdPessoaProprietario($_SESSION['idPessoaProprietario']); $obj->setDescricao($_POST['consulta']); $obj->setDocumento($_POST['consulta']); $resultados = $obj->consultar(); $status = sizeof($resultados) > 0 ? 'OK' : 'NO'; } } catch (PDOException $e) { $status = 'ERRO'; } echo json_encode(array('status' => $status, 'resultados' => $resultados));
<?php include_once '../../../config.php'; try { $status = 'ERRO'; if (isset($_SESSION['idPessoaProprietario']) && isset($_POST)) { $conta = new ContaReceber(Conf::pegCnxPadrao()); $parcelas = (int) $_POST['parcela']; if (empty($parcelas) || $parcelas < 1) { $parcelas = 1; } for ($parcela = 1; $parcela <= $parcelas; $parcela++) { $conta->setDados($_POST); $conta->setSituacao('ABERTO'); $conta->setParcela($parcela); $conta->setParcelas($parcelas); $conta->setIdPessoaProprietario($_SESSION['idPessoaProprietario']); $conta->_salvar(); } $_SESSION['msg'] = Utilitarios::msgSucesso('Conta salva com sucesso!', true); header("Location: ../../../sistema.php?action=contareceber"); } //$retorno = array('status'=>$status); } catch (PDOException $e) { $_SESSION['msg'] = Utilitarios::msgErro('Erro ao tentar salvar', true); header("Location: ../../../sistema.php?action=contareceber"); } //echo json_encode($retorno);
<?php try { include_once '../../../config.php'; if (isset($_SESSION['idPessoaProprietario'])) { $cr = new ContaReceber(Conf::pegCnxPadrao()); $cr->setIdPessoaProprietario($_SESSION['idPessoaProprietario']); $cr->setIdContaReceber($_POST['idContaReceber']); $cr->getDados(); var_dump($cr); } else { Utilitarios::msgAtencao('Falha ao tentar exibir as informações da conta!'); } } catch (PDOException $e) { Utilitarios::msgAtencao('Erro ao tentar exibir as informações da conta.'); }
<?php include_once 'app/view/backend/menufinanceiro.php'; ?> <div class="main-content"> <?php $cr = new ContaReceber(Conf::pegCnxPadrao()); $titulo = 'Lançamento de conta a receber'; if (isset($_GET['idbanco'])) { $titulo = 'Editar lançamento'; $cr->setIdBanco($_GET['idbanco']); $cr->getDados(); } ?> <div class="breadcrumbs" id="breadcrumbs"> <script type="text/javascript"> try{ace.settings.check('breadcrumbs' , 'fixed')}catch(e){} </script> <ul class="breadcrumb"> <li> <i class="ace-icon fa fa-home home-icon"></i> <a href="sistema.php">Início</a> </li> <li class="active"><?php echo $titulo; ?> </li>